CCTV Captures Horror Crash on Nuh Road: Speeding Car Hits Pedestrian, Crashes Into Vehicles and Tile Showroom

The road accident was recorded on CCTV cameras at Chharoda Bus Stand on Nuh Road, where a fast moving car apparently lost control and caused a chain collision on Wednesday.

According to the CCTV footage, the speeding car suddenly spun out of control and struck a pedestrian walking near the roadside. The force of the collision threw the pedestrian into the air before the vehicle continued moving forward.

After hitting the pedestrian, the car crashed into several parked vehicles, including a pickup truck and a motorcycle. The vehicle continued its path of destruction before finally crashing into a tile showroom at the bus stand.

The incident created panic among residents and shopkeepers in the area. A few people rushed to the accident site immediately after hearing the loud impact. People gathered around the damaged vehicles and tried to help those injured in the crash.

Three persons were seriously injured in the accident, police said. The injured victims were treated and sent to Shaheed Hasan Khan Mewati Medical College in Nalhar for further treatment.

After the accident, police officers arrived on the spot and opened investigations into the incident. A case has been registered and the police are investigating, examining CCTV footage from the area to determine the exact sequence of events.

There is some indication that excessive speed contributed to the crash at the time of the collision, but more details are still being gathered, which, according to the authorities, will not be known until the investigation is complete and results have been provided.

The CCTV footage will provide clues on the driver’s actions in the moments before the collision.
